Reforming the Indian Skill System Read more about Reforming the Indian Skill System This presentation introduces the National Skill Qualification Framework and the new Vocational Education and Training Act in India. Reforming the apprenticeship system, including financing of skill development on a much wider scale, is discussed. The plan to develop a Labour Management Information System is explained.

Meeting the Challenges of Skilled Workforce Development in Malaysia Read more about Meeting the Challenges of Skilled Workforce Development in Malaysia This presentation describes the technical vocational education and training landscape in Malaysia. It introduces the National Dual Training System, a workplace training program instituted by the Malaysian Government. The main issues in skills training faced by stakeholders and the initiatives developed to address them are discussed.
